I am currently setting up a database on global airports and I have an issue with two columns that I want to remain linked.

For example:

Airport NameIATA
Code
Adelaide International AirportADL
Bendigo AirportBXG
Brisbane International AirportBNE
Canberra International AirportCBR

Once my database is complete, I want to be able to sort the data I have entered, but as the IATA code is directly connected to the airport, I want the two columns to be sorted together. In the eventuality that someone wishes to sort airports A-Z, I want the IATA code to be sorted with it.

Excel Facts

VLOOKUP to Left?
Use =VLOOKUP(A2,CHOOSE({1,2},$Z$1:$Z$99,$Y$1:$Y$99),2,False) to lookup Y values to left of Z values.
Airport Name in column A, IATA code in B
Highlight both columns at the top
Click on DATA
Click on SORT
Sort by Column A
This will sort the Airports A-Z (default) - but you can change the order as well...
